Rob Fukuzaki Biography and Wikipedia

Rob Fukuzaki is an American journalist and correspondent currently working as a news Sports anchor at ABC7 News, KABC television based in Los Angeles, California. Fukuzaki has covered major sports stories and events such as the Kings Stanley Cup finals and Lakers Championships. He is also the host of Special sports podcasts such as Slam Dunk, and Saturday Night Sports, as well as Chargers pre and post-game shows.

Rob Fukuzaki Education

Fukuzaki joined and graduated from Mid-Pacific Institute High School based in Honolulu. He later attended the University of La Verne in Southern California and earned a bachelor of arts degree in Broadcast Journalism with an emphasis on television and radio. While at University, Rob won the University’s reporter of the year for three consecutive years.

Rob Fukuzaki ABC News

Fukuzaki works as the weekday sports reporter for ABC7 Eyewitness News on KABC television based in Los Angeles, California. He is the host of Special sports podcasts including Slam Dunk, and Saturday Night Sports as well as Chargers pre-and post-game shows. Notably, he was the first male Japanese-American television reporter in Los Angeles local TV news.

Rob has covered major sports such as Stanley Cup Finals, World Series, Super Bowls, Championship Boxing, and NBA Finals. Moreover, Fukuzaki was inducted into the Southern California Sports Broadcasters Hall of Fame in 2016 along with his heroes Chick Hearn, Vin Scully, and Bob Miller. Rob started her reporting career serving the Top 40 radio network KXPW in Hawaii. Later, he went to KITV television working as a part-time sports journalist in Honolulu. Amazingly, he also got a full-time slot serving as a weekend anchor and weekday sports reporter for KITV television.
